I've got problem with my NEC 1300A...when I try to burn DVD 4x speed there's a message:"POWER CALIBRAION ERROR".
I've received thios message a couple of times when I burned for 2-3hours and it was very hot....when it cools down everything was OK.
BUT now I can't burn anything with 4x speed..only 2x,which is terribly slow:(((
I tryed 1.08,1.09 and now 1.0A firmware with the same result...I use DVD-R Multidisk 4x all the time and there was no problem with them.I asked some friends and they told me it should be the media....does anyone else have his kind of problem???
Thanks Martin.
 
usually power calibration errors more often than not relate to bad / poor media try burning slower say 2x or 1 x see if that helps :)

other than that try a different media :)

you may find that you could have a bad batch :(
